Base Installation
Step 1
A toilet base is shown with a yellow wax ring and a grey gasket being fitted into the outlet. Orange arrows indicate the direction of placement for these components.
Step 2
The toilet base is positioned above a black floor flange. Two metal bolts are visible, inserted through the flange and into the floor. Orange arrows show the toilet base being lowered onto the bolts.
Step 3
The base of the toilet is now secured to the floor. A bolt, washer, and nut assembly is shown on each side, with orange arrows indicating the tightening action.
Water Tank Installation
Step 1
The underside of a toilet water tank is depicted. Three bolts with washers and nuts are shown, with orange arrows indicating their assembly and tightening into the tank.
Step 2
Two large rubber gaskets are shown being placed onto the bolts that extend from the underside of the water tank. Orange arrows indicate the placement of these gaskets.
Step 3
The water tank is being attached to the toilet base. Bolts pass through the tank and into the base, secured by washers and nuts. Orange arrows show the process of tightening these connections.
